shotblast is a versatile process that can be used for a variety of purposes, including surface cleaning, surface preparation, rust removal, deburring, and more. The process involves shooting abrasive material at high speed onto a surface to achieve the desired finish. The abrasive material can range from steel shots, glass beads, aluminum oxide, to even garnet. Each abrasive material is chosen based on the surface being treated and the desired finish.

In the construction industry, shotblast is commonly used for surface preparation before applying coatings or overlays. By removing contaminants, old coatings, and surface imperfections, shotblast creates a clean and roughened surface that enhances the adhesion of coatings. This ensures a long-lasting and durable finish that can withstand harsh environmental conditions.
In the automotive industry, shotblast is used for various applications such as paint removal, surface cleaning, and rust removal. The precision of shotblast allows for targeted treatment of specific areas without damaging surrounding components. This is crucial for maintaining the integrity of automotive parts and achieving high-quality finishes.
In the aerospace industry, shotblast plays a vital role in preparing surfaces for bonding, welding, or painting. The cleanliness and roughness achieved through shotblast ensure strong adhesion of components and coatings, crucial for the safety and performance of aircraft components.
